automation-hub
2024.10
true
- Open API
- Einführung in die Automation Hub API
- API-Referenzen
- Generieren Sie Ihr Token im Automation Hub
- Authentifizierung bei der Automation Hub-API
- Fügen Sie Benutzer mithilfe von OpenAPI massenweise zum Automation Hub hinzu
- Bearbeiten Sie Benutzer im Automation Hub mit OpenAPI massenweise
- Abrufen einer Automatisierungsidee in der Phase „Idee“ und dem Status „Überprüfung ausstehend“
- Abrufen der Kosten-Nutzen-Analyse für eine bestimmte Idee
- Aktualisieren von Phase und Status einer Automatisierungsidee
- Abrufen eines Benutzerkontos
- Aktualisieren der Kontodetails für Mitarbeiter im Automation Hub
- Deaktivieren von Benutzerkonten, die nicht Teil des Unternehmens sind
- Eingabe für Automatisierungspipeline
- Eingabe für Einreichungstyp
- Eingabe für Phase
- Eingabe für Status
- Eingabe für Phasen- und Statusaktualisierung
- Eingabe für Geschäftseinheit
- Eingabe für Anwendungen
- Eingabe für Kategorie
- Eingabe für Kosten-Nutzen-Analyse
- Eingabe für einfache Bewertung
- Eingabe für Detaillierte Bewertung
- Eingabe für Erstellungsdatum der Automatisierungsidee
- Eingabe für Benutzer
- Eingabe für Benutzerstatus
- Benutzerstatustabelle
- Eingabe für Mitarbeitende
- Ausgabe-Wörterbuch
- Power Query-Analysen für Daten aus der Automation Hub Open API
Abrufen einer Automatisierungsidee in der Phase „Idee“ und dem Status „Überprüfung ausstehend“
Wichtig :
Bitte beachten Sie, dass dieser Inhalt teilweise mithilfe von maschineller Übersetzung lokalisiert wurde.
Automation Hub-API-Handbuch
Last updated 11. Nov. 2024
Abrufen einer Automatisierungsidee in der Phase „Idee“ und dem Status „Überprüfung ausstehend“
Die folgende Anforderung veranschaulicht, wie die Details für alle in Ihrem Mandanten registrierten Automatisierungsideen abgerufen werden, die den folgenden Kriterien entsprechen:
-
Idee befindet sich in der Ideenphase: phases=1
-
Ihr Status lautet „Überprüfung ausstehend“: status=46
-
Kategorie-ID ist: category=717
Hinweis:
Verwenden Sie die niedrigste Kategorie-ID, damit die gesamte Kette eingegeben wird.
GET:
https://{yourDomain}/automationhub_/api/v1/openapi/automations?category=717
Anforderung:
Headers
Content-Type: application/json
Authorization: Bearer [Tenant ID/Token]
x-ah-openapi-app-key: [API key if added]
x-ah-openapi-auth: openapi-token
Headers
Content-Type: application/json
Authorization: Bearer [Tenant ID/Token]
x-ah-openapi-app-key: [API key if added]
x-ah-openapi-auth: openapi-token
Antwort:
Content-Type: application/json
{
"message": "Success",
"statusCode": 200,
"data": {
"page": 1,
"pageSize": 4,
"totalItems": 4,
"totalPages": 1,
"processes": [
{
"process_id": 1,
"process_slug": "onboarding-of-new-employee",
"process_submitter_user_id": 2,
"process_name": "Onboarding of new employee",
"process_description": "{\"blocks\":
"process_rules_id": 2,
"process_input_type_id": 6,
"process_stability_id": 17,
"process_input_structure_id": 11,
"process_documentation_availability_ids": "21",
"owner": 2,
"process_created_epoch": 1600350166000,
"process_created_at": "2020-09-17T13:42:46.000Z",
"process_updated_epoch": 1600350166000,
"process_updated_at": "2020-09-17T13:42:46.000Z",
"process_updated_user_id": 1,
"process_phase_id": 9,
"process_phase_status_id": 89,
"process_challenges_encountered":
...see more fields examples in swagger or postman documentation
{
"message": "Success",
"statusCode": 200,
"data": {
"page": 1,
"pageSize": 4,
"totalItems": 4,
"totalPages": 1,
"processes": [
{
"process_id": 1,
"process_slug": "onboarding-of-new-employee",
"process_submitter_user_id": 2,
"process_name": "Onboarding of new employee",
"process_description": "{\"blocks\":
"process_rules_id": 2,
"process_input_type_id": 6,
"process_stability_id": 17,
"process_input_structure_id": 11,
"process_documentation_availability_ids": "21",
"owner": 2,
"process_created_epoch": 1600350166000,
"process_created_at": "2020-09-17T13:42:46.000Z",
"process_updated_epoch": 1600350166000,
"process_updated_at": "2020-09-17T13:42:46.000Z",
"process_updated_user_id": 1,
"process_phase_id": 9,
"process_phase_status_id": 89,
"process_challenges_encountered":
...see more fields examples in swagger or postman documentation